| dis·as·ter ar·e·a (plural dis·as·ter ar·e·as) |
noun |
|
| Definition: |
| |
1. place needing government assistance: a place that is officially declared to be in a state of emergency and in need of special assistance such as federal relief money after a natural disaster
 The southern half of the state has been declared a disaster area.
|
2. mess: a very messy or disorganized place or situation
(
informal
)
